Releases: idrawjs/idraw
Releases · idrawjs/idraw
v0.4.0-beta.24
- feat(renderer): add
scaleMode
to enhance image of renderer - feat(renderer): add
fillRule
to enhance path of renderer - feat(core): optimize grid render of ruler middleware
- refactor: rename
helperContext
andunderContext
tooverlayContext
andunderlayContext
v0.4.0-beta.23
Features 🚀
- feat: enhance text element
v0.4.0-beta.22
🚀 Features
- feat: optimize render of circle element
v0.4.0-beta.21
🚀 Features
- feat: rename disable* to disabled* of layout operations
v0.4.0-beta.20
🚀 Features
- feat: add event to disable selecting in group
v0.4.0-beta.19
🚀 Features
- feat(core): add middleware of layout selector
- feat(types): enhance
DataLayout
- feat(util): improve
centerContent
to supportDataLayout
🛠 Fix
- fix(renderer): fix text render logic #303
v0.4.0-beta.18
🚀 Features
- feat(core): add info middleware
- feat(core): improve select middleware to control grid unit
- feat(core): improve ruler and scroller middleware
- feat(renderer): rename
data.underlay
tolayout
v0.4.0-beta.17
🚀 Features
- feat(core): add reference lines for middleware select
- feat(idraw): add feature switch of scroll and scale
- feat(board): add calculation cache data of
viewRectInfo
to calculator - feat(util): add calculation methods about
viewRectInfo
- feat(types): add types about
viewRectInfo
v0.4.0-beta.16
💥 Breaking changes
- refactor(idraw): refactor mode of selecting, dragging and readonly.
🚀 Features
- feat(util): add tools of calc view range.
- feat(util): deprecated deepclone data of Store.getSnapshot
🔧 Bug Fixes
- fix(core): fix edit text keyboard of delete action.
v0.4.0-beta.15
- feat(idraw): sort events and export
eventKeys
- feat(renderer): optimize render for reducing the number of redraws.
- feat(core): initialize auxiliary lines for middleware selector